Organisation:
Highly regarded independent charity focused on health and health care in the UK
Role:
The Assistant Research Officer is a key member of the organisation’s Research Team, ensuring research management processes are carried out to a high standard, supporting research grant holders manage their projects and supporting the dissemination of research findings.
In this role you will:
- Support effective contract management, award administration and project management of a portfolio of research grants and commissioned research projects
- Support the tendering, contracting and commissioning process
- Support events management for external stakeholder events
- Ensure high quality processes, information and communication to support the work of the Research Team.
